Re: Conduitra broker bump to 4.x — mostly mechanical, but note the consumer prefetch semantics changed, so our old settings will over-fetch and starve slow workers during failover. If you're paged mid-rollout, roll back the config, not the binary. I've pinned sane values in the deploy overlay; the constants we're shipping with are below.

tuning table, yajog-yahof:
BUDGETS = {
    "lamvan": 303,
    "wenox": 460,
    "fenvan": 525,
}

I'm rotating off, so here's what you need. The service crawls rates for Bellhaven Hospitality properties every four hours and flags mismatches between our channel manager and third-party listings. Mira owned the scraper pool; Tomas owns alerting now. Known quirks: the Larkspur Inn feed lags a day, and currency rounding false-positives are suppressed via a threshold flag. Deploys go through the staging gate first, no exceptions. Before touching anything, review the current service configuration, reproduced below.

settings of kajep-kawip:
[zorys]
host = zorys.urlaqgrid.corp
user = zorys_svc
database = zorys_prod

Subject: Quickstore 4.2 — bloom filter now fronts the KV layer

Plugin authors: starting with this release, Quickstore places a bloom filter ahead of the key-value store. Negative lookups return faster; false positives fall through safely. No API changes are required on your side. Verify your plugin against the staging build referenced below.

session token of fahif-tadup = htk3_9c7